[rep-gtk] added GtkExpander from 2.12 API
- From: Christopher Bratusek <chrisb src gnome org>
- To: svn-commits-list gnome org
- Cc:
- Subject: [rep-gtk] added GtkExpander from 2.12 API
- Date: Mon, 7 Dec 2009 19:46:01 +0000 (UTC)
commit 85c8374b5940ae20334cbf04fbd266752e290fd4
Author: Christopher Roy Bratusek <chris nanolx org>
Date: Mon Dec 7 20:45:02 2009 +0100
added GtkExpander from 2.12 API
ChangeLog | 19 +++++++++++++++++
NEWS | 16 ++++++++++++++
gtk.defs | 66 +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
3 files changed, 101 insertions(+), 0 deletions(-)
---
diff --git a/ChangeLog b/ChangeLog
index bad6b3c..d66f496 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,22 @@
+2009-12-06 Christopher Bratusek <zanghar freenet de>
+ * gtk.defs: GtkExpander implemented
+ ************** gtkexpander.h *****************
+ gtk_expander_new
+ gtk_expander_new_with_mnemonic
+ gtk_expander_set_expanded
+ gtk_expander_get_expanded
+ gtk_expander_set_spacing
+ gtk_expander_get_spacing
+ gtk_expander_set_label
+ gtk_expander_get_label
+ gtk_expander_set_use_underline
+ gtk_expander_get_use_underline
+ gtk_expander_set_use_markup
+ gtk_expander_get_use_markup
+ gtk_expander_set_label_widget
+ gtk_expander_get_label_widget
+ == GtkExpander 2.12 API complete ==
+
2009-12-05 Christopher Bratusek <zanghar freenet de>
* configure.in
* debian/rules: use $prefix/lib instead of $prefix/libdir
diff --git a/NEWS b/NEWS
index 210fa07..3aa9ced 100644
--- a/NEWS
+++ b/NEWS
@@ -6,6 +6,22 @@ Addtitions:
GtkAction support [Jürgen Hötzel]
2.12 APIs added:
+ ************** gtkexpander.h *****************
+ gtk_expander_new
+ gtk_expander_new_with_mnemonic
+ gtk_expander_set_expanded
+ gtk_expander_get_expanded
+ gtk_expander_set_spacing
+ gtk_expander_get_spacing
+ gtk_expander_set_label
+ gtk_expander_get_label
+ gtk_expander_set_use_underline
+ gtk_expander_get_use_underline
+ gtk_expander_set_use_markup
+ gtk_expander_get_use_markup
+ gtk_expander_set_label_widget
+ gtk_expander_get_label_widget
+ == GtkExpander 2.12 API complete ==
*********** gtkcomboboxentry.h ***********
gtk_combo_box_entry_new
gtk_combo_box_entry_new_with_model
diff --git a/gtk.defs b/gtk.defs
index c829d91..d3feb02 100644
--- a/gtk.defs
+++ b/gtk.defs
@@ -5424,6 +5424,72 @@
(GtkAction action)
(string accelerator)))
+;; GtkExpander
+
+(define-object GtkExpander (GtkBin))
+
+(define-func gtk_expander_new
+ GtkWidget
+ (((tvec string in) label)))
+
+(define-func gtk_expander_new_with_mnemonic
+ GtkWidget
+ (((tvec string in) label)))
+
+(define-func gtk_expander_set_expanded
+ none
+ ((GtkExpander expander)
+ (bool expanded)))
+
+(define-func gtk_expander_get_expanded
+ bool
+ ((GtkExpander expander)))
+
+(define-func gtk_expander_set_spacing
+ none
+ ((GtkExpander expander)
+ (int spacing)))
+
+(define-func gtk_expander_get_spacing
+ int
+ ((GtkExpander expander)))
+
+(define-func gtk_expander_set_label
+ none
+ ((GtkExpander expander)
+ ((tvec string in) label)))
+
+(define-func gtk_expander_get_label
+ static_string
+ ((GtkExpander expander)))
+
+(define-func gtk_expander_set_use_underline
+ none
+ ((GtkExpander expander)
+ (bool use_underline)))
+
+(define-func gtk_expander_get_use_underline
+ bool
+ ((GtkExpander expander)))
+
+(define-func gtk_expander_set_use_markup
+ none
+ ((GtkExpander expander)
+ (bool use_markup)))
+
+(define-func gtk_expander_get_use_markup
+ bool
+ ((GtkExpander expander)))
+
+(define-func gtk_expander_set_label_widget
+ none
+ ((GtkExpander expander)
+ (GtkWidget label_widget)))
+
+(define-func gtk_expander_get_label_widget
+ GtkWidget
+ ((GtkExpander expander)))
+
;; More defs files
(include "gtktext.defs")
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]